My Background and Approach
I have experience working with adolescents, adults, couples, and groups around the topics of addiction, anxiety, depression, cultural issues, Third Culture Kids, Missionary Kids, transitions, grief, marital issues, and identity issues. I graduated from Covenant Theological Seminary in 2019 with my Masters in Counseling and am pursuing full licensure in Missouri under the supervision of Tyler Sparks.
